Dragon Ball Z: Kakarot DLC 6 – The Short and Peaceful World

Dragon Ball Z: Kakarot, the RPG that lets you relive the iconic events of Dragon Ball Z, is back with its sixth DLC pack. This time, we’re diving into the End of Z Saga, also known as the Peaceful World Saga. But wait, there’s a catch! This arc is short, really short. So how does Dragon Ball Z: Kakarot tackle this challenge? Let’s find out!
First, a little backstory. The Peaceful World Saga takes place ten years after Goku’s epic battle with Buu. Goku finds himself participating in the 28th World Martial Arts Tournament, where he meets a child named Uub, who is actually the good-guy reincarnation of Buu. Goku, being Goku, offers to train Uub to be the next protector of the world.

Now, adapting the Peaceful World Saga into the game is no walk in the Hyperbolic Time Chamber. Why? Well, there’s not much action to cover in the source material. But fear not! There are ways to expand upon this short arc.
For starters, the tournament itself could offer more matches for the players to conquer. Additionally, spending time with other characters like Pan, Goten, and Trunks during their friendly sparring sessions could provide some light-hearted fun. And let’s not forget about Goku training Uub – this is a golden opportunity to delve deeper into their mentor-student dynamic.
But the End of Z Saga isn’t the only challenge that Dragon Ball Z: Kakarot’s DLC 6 faces. The rumors surrounding future DLCs suggest that content from Dragon Ball Super and Dragon Ball GT might make their way into the game. This raises questions about the game’s timeline, as Super takes place during the 10-year gap before the Peaceful World Saga, while GT follows the events of that arc.
